About Monero (XMR)

What Is Monero?

Launched in 2014, Monero (XMR) is the first cryptocurrency that prioritizes user privacy and fungibility. In contrast to other popular c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in or Ethereum, which can be tracked on public ledgers, Monero ensures transactions remain untraceable and private, capturing the attention of users, investors, and privacy advocates alike.

Under the pseudonym "Thankful_for_today," Monero was originally developed and later nurtured by a dedicated group of developers, adhering to principles of decentralization, community-driven development, and anonymity. While forked from the Bytecoin codebase, it underwent substantial enhancements and optimizations, establishing itself as an independent and private coin.

How Does Monero Work?

Monero's privacy features are underpinned by five key technologies:

- Ring Signatures enable transaction anonymity by combining a user's signature with others in the network, forming an indistinguishable "ring" of potential signers, effectively masking the true sender.

- Ring Confidential Transactions (RingCT) conceals transaction amounts, encrypting this information so that only the sender and receiver can access it, maintaining the confidentiality of each Monero coin's transaction history.

- Stealth Addresses adds an extra layer of privacy by generating unique, one-time addresses for each transaction, making it exceedingly difficult to link the receiver's address to their identity.

- To bolster privacy, Monero allows transactions to be conducted over the anonymous Tor and I2P networks, obscuring the origin and destination of transactions and protecting users' IP addresses and physical locations.

- Dandelion++: Monero further enhances transaction privacy with the Dandelion++ protocol. Transactions pass through a "stem" phase, shared with a single neighboring node, before probabilistically being broadcast to the entire network, making it tough for adversaries to trace the transaction's origin.

Monero project analysis

Monero (XMR) is a decentralized, open-source cryptocurrency that prioritizes privacy and security, distinguishing itself from other digital currencies through its robust anonymity features. Launched in 2014, Monero has become a leading privacy coin, offering users untraceable and confidential transactions.

Privacy and Security Features

Monero employs several advanced cryptographic techniques to ensure transaction privacy:

  • Ring Signatures: This method combines a user's transaction with multiple others, making it challenging to identify the actual sender.

  • Stealth Addresses: Unique, one-time addresses are generated for each transaction, ensuring that recipient addresses remain confidential.

  • Ring Confidential Transactions (RingCT): Introduced in 2017, RingCT conceals transaction amounts, enhancing overall privacy.

  • Bulletproofs: Implemented to reduce transaction sizes and fees, Bulletproofs further improve the efficiency and scalability of the network.

These features collectively ensure that Monero transactions are private by default, providing users with a high level of anonymity.

Mining and Decentralization

Monero utilizes the RandomX proof-of-work algorithm, designed to be resistant to specialized mining hardware (ASICs). This approach promotes mining decentralization by allowing efficient mining on consumer-grade hardware, thereby preventing centralization of mining power. The network's dynamic block size adapts to demand, ensuring scalability and consistent transaction processing times.

Development and Community

Monero boasts a vibrant and active development community, ranking third in developer activity among cryptocurrencies, following Bitcoin and Ethereum. The project operates on a decentralized, community-driven model, with contributions from developers, researchers, and users worldwide. Regular protocol upgrades and enhancements, such as the planned implementation of Bulletproofs++ and the increase of ring sizes, demonstrate Monero's commitment to continuous improvement and innovation.

Regulatory Landscape

Monero's strong privacy features have attracted attention from regulatory bodies and exchanges. Some countries, including Japan and South Korea, have banned privacy coins like Monero to mitigate potential illicit activities. Major exchanges have also delisted Monero in response to regulatory pressures. Despite these challenges, Monero continues to maintain a dedicated user base that values financial privacy.

Future Roadmap

Monero's development roadmap includes several key initiatives aimed at enhancing privacy, security, and usability:

  • Implementation of Bulletproofs++: An upgrade to the existing Bulletproofs protocol to further reduce transaction sizes and improve efficiency.

  • Increase in Ring Size: Expanding the default ring size to over 100 to enhance transaction anonymity.

  • Integration of Triptych: Introducing logarithmic-sized linkable ring signatures to improve scalability and privacy.

  • Development of Second-Layer Solutions: Exploring solutions to enhance transaction speed and scalability without compromising privacy.

These initiatives underscore Monero's dedication to maintaining its position as a leading privacy-focused cryptocurrency.
